Choosing hair clippers involves evaluating a variety of features that cater to different user needs and preferences.
-
Motor Type: The motor type in hair clippers impacts performance and speed. Rotary motors are powerful and suitable for thick hair. Magnetic motors provide rapid cutting but may overheat. Pivot motors offer high torque and are great for heavy-duty cutting.
-
Blade Quality and Type: The quality of the blades determines the cutting efficiency and longevity. Stainless steel blades are durable and resist rust. Ceramic blades stay sharper longer and generate less heat. Blades can also vary in thickness, affecting the finish of the cut.
-
Adjustable Length Settings: Adjustable length settings allow users to style hair at different lengths. Some clippers have built-in taper levers for precise length adjustments. Others come with multiple guard attachments for versatility in haircuts.
-
Corded vs. Cordless: Corded clippers offer continuous power but limit movement. Cordless models provide flexibility but are dependent on battery life. Users should consider their comfort with either type based on their haircutting habits.
-
Ergonomics and Weight: The design of hair clippers affects user comfort. Lightweight and ergonomically designed models reduce fatigue during prolonged use. Clippers that fit comfortably in the hand enhance precision.
-
Noise Level: Noise levels vary among clippers. Quiet motors are preferable for home use, especially in families with children. Noisy clippers may be less suitable for professional settings where concentration is vital.
-
Battery Life (for cordless models): Battery life is crucial for cordless clippers. Users should check how long the clippers can operate on a single charge. The recharge time also matters, particularly for those who need quick touch-ups.
-
Accessories Included: Some clippers come with additional accessories, like combs, scissors, or cleaning brushes. These extras add value and convenience, fostering a complete grooming kit.
-
Price Range and Brand Reputation: The price of hair clippers can vary widely. Established brands often provide reliable options but at a higher price. It’s essential to balance budget with quality, especially for professional use.
-
Maintenance and Durability: Regular maintenance extends the life of hair clippers. Users should look for models with easy cleaning processes and replaceable parts. Durability influences long-term investment; quality clippers can last for years with proper care.

What Maintenance Tips Ensure the Longevity of Your Hair Clippers?
To ensure the longevity of your hair clippers, regular maintenance is essential. Proper care includes cleaning, oiling, and storing the clippers correctly.
- Clean the blades after each use.
- Oil the blades regularly.
- Store clippers in a protective case.
- Replace worn-out parts as needed.
- Avoid using clippers on wet hair.
- Check the power cord for damage.
- Keep clippers dry and dust-free.
Maintaining hair clippers not only extends their lifespan but also enhances their performance and efficiency.
-
Cleaning the Blades:
Cleaning the blades after each use is crucial for hair clippers. Residue from hair products and hair clippings can build up and affect performance. Regular cleaning helps prevent rust and corrosion, ensuring optimal cutting efficiency. Additionally, a buildup of hair can lead to overheating. A study by the International Journal of Trichology (2018) indicated that unclogged clippers operate more efficiently, prolonging their functional life. -
Oiling the Blades:
Oiling the blades regularly keeps them lubricated, reducing friction and wear. This maintenance practice aids in achieving a smoother cut. According to the manufacturer’s guidelines, you should oil the blades after every 5-10 uses. This not only prolongs the blades’ life but also improves the clippers’ overall cutting capability. Products like clipper oil are specifically designed for this purpose, preventing rust. -
Storing Clippers Properly:
Storing clippers in a protective case prevents dust accumulation and potential damage. A solid case protects against moisture, which can lead to rust. It’s also advisable to keep clippers in a cool, dry place. Studies emphasize proper storage as a key aspect of maintaining electronic devices (Cutt et al., 2021). -
Replacing Worn-Out Parts:
Replacing worn-out parts, such as blades and guards, enhances the clippers’ performance. Dull blades can tug at hair, increasing the risk of cuts or injuries. Regular inspections for wear and tear should be a routine practice. Maintaining skilled equipment ensures high standards of grooming. Some opinions suggest that investing in high-quality replacement parts can yield better long-term results. -
Avoiding Wet Hair:
Avoiding the use of clippers on wet hair is highly recommended. Wet hair can cause clippers to tug and pull, leading to poor performance and potential damage. Dry hair ensures even cutting and helps maintain blade sharpness. Professional hairstylists often emphasize the importance of dry hair for optimal clipper function. -
Checking the Power Cord:
Checking the power cord for damage regularly is important for safety. A frayed or damaged cord can lead to electrical hazards. Electrical inspections can also avoid potential failures during usage. The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) suggests keeping equipment in good working condition to prevent workplace accidents. -
Keeping Clippers Dry and Dust-Free:
Keeping clippers dry and dust-free is essential to prevent internal damage. Dust can infiltrate the internal components, impacting the motor’s performance. Using a soft cloth after use can remove dust and moisture. Studies in equipment maintenance highlight the benefit of a clean environment in extending product life (Jones, 2020).
